When most people imagined robots as cold machines, Cynthia Breazeal envisioned something radically different: social robots that could interact meaningfully with humans. As a pioneering professor at MIT's Media Lab and founder of Jibo, Inc.

, she has transformed how we understand human-robot interaction. Her Personal Robotics Group represents the cutting edge of social robotics research, developing intelligent systems that can communicate, learn, and engage in genuinely interactive ways.

By bridging computer science, cognitive psychology, and design, Breazeal is creating technologies that could revolutionize everything from healthcare to education.
